Open the WQMS-Modules Excel file.
-
Navigate to InspectionDef sheet > WQMSInspectionDef section, modify the following properties:
-
UID - Type a unique identifier for the module in the UID syntax.
-
Name - Type a name for the module.
-
Description - Provide a short description of the module.
-
WQMSModuleName - Type a name for the module that must be displayed in the UI.
-
WQMSModuleDisplayDescription - Provide the tool tip to describe the module.
-
WQMSModuleImage - Specify the icon name for the module. You can use only the existing icons within the module.
-
WQMSModuleViewClass - Specify the view (Column Set-Column Items) for a module or submodule.
-
WQMSInspectionModuleType - Specify the discipline name of the module. For piping, enter PIP and for structural enter STR.
-
WQMSInspectionType - Specify the inspection type.
-
WQMSNOIFormUID - Specify the UID for the form to create an NOI. To create a UID, refer to Define a UID for NOI and ROI forms.
-
WQMSNOIClassDef - Specify the class name of the module.
-
WQMSNOIGridColumnSet - Specify the column-set UID for the NOI.
-
WQMSNOIInspItemsProperty - By default, type WQMSInspItemData for this property.
-
WQMSROIFormUID - Specify the UIDs of the two forms to create ROIs, one from NOI and other from drawings. These two UIDs must be separated with a # symbol.
For example, FRM_WQMSROI_FUP_Structure_Form#FRM_WQMSROI_Drawing_FUP_Structure_Form.
For UIDs, refer to Define a UID for NOI and ROI forms. -
WQMSROIClassDef - Specify the class name of the module ROI.
-
WQMSRROIGridColumnSet - Specify the column-set UID for the ROI.
-
WQMSNOIQualificationProperty - This property value must be empty.
-
WQMSROIAcceptanceProperty - Set this property to accepted, to complete the ROI. You can provide multiple properties and separate them with a | symbol.
For example, WQMSWeld_MATERV_Result1|WQMSWeld_MATERV_Result2. -
WQMSNOIInspItemsColumnSet - Specify the column-set UID for Manage Inspection Items for NOI. To display Welder List column set, provide the column-set UIDs and separate them with a # symbol.
For example, CS_WQMSSTRMVFUNOIComp_ColumnSet#CS_WQMSWeldEdgeInfo_ColumnSet. -
WQMSROIInspItemsColumnSet - Specify the column-set UID for Manage Inspection Items for ROI. To display Welder List column set, provide the column sets UIDs and separate them with a # symbol.
For example, CS_WQMSSTRMVFUROIComp_ColumnSet#CS_WQMSWeldEdgeInfo_ColumnSet. -
WQMSWeldRepairEntries - Specify the repair Enum entries.
For example, RepairSegment, Reweld, or DoNothing. To provide multiple values, separate them with a comma (,) -
WQMSInspectionItemsClassDef - Specify the class definition for Manage Inspection Items.
-
WQMSInspItemsDisciplineProp - Specify the discipline property for Manage Inspection Items.
-
WQMSInspDefApplicableWhen - Specify if the welds are applicable for this module.
For example, WQMSWeld_FUP_IsPreWHTReq~ELT_WQMSYorNA_Y. When the IsPreWHTReq is set to Y, the welds appear in this module. -
WQMSIsInInspectionProperty - Specify it as WQMSWeld_IsInInspection. Set to TRUE, when NOI or ROI is created.
-
WQMSInspRejectResetColumnset - Specify the UID for the column-set that contains some of the rejected weld properties. The rejected weld has a repair segment status.
-
WQMSInspCutResetColumnset - Specify the UID for the column-set that contains some of the rejected weld properties. The rejected weld has a reweld status.
-
WQMSInspUserProperty - Specify the property name on which the user name must be stamped while accepting or rejecting a weld.
To stamp the user name on the welder list, specify the property name separated with a # symbol. -
WQMSInspDateProperty - Specify the property name on which the inspection date must be stamped while accepting or rejecting a weld.
To stamp the date on the welder list, specify the property name separated with a # symbol. -
WQMSInspRejectReasonProperty - Specify the property name on which the accept or reject reason must be stamped while accepting or rejecting a weld.
To stamp the accept or reject reason on the welder list, specify the property name separated with a # symbol. -
WQMSInspReportNumberProperty - Specify the property name on which the inspection report number must be stamped while accepting or rejecting a weld.
-
Solution(s) - Type * to load the data to SPF database, or type Deleted to avoid loading the data to SPF database.
-
ContainerID - Defines the package or .xml file that contains the object.
-
-
Save the file.
